Last updated: April 2026 dataLarge-cylinder circular knitting machines produce wider tubular fabrics used in T-shirts, sportswear, underwear, and technical knits, making them central equipment for high-volume jersey and interlock fabric mills. Five 10-digit lines cover this heading, distinguishing hosiery machines (8447121000), open-top cylinder machines (8447129010), cylinder-and-dial machines (8447129020), and other non-hosiery types (8447129090). Japan leads US imports, followed by Germany and Italy — a supply profile that reflects the dominance of Japanese manufacturers in large-diameter, high-speed circular knitting technology. The cylinder-and-dial distinction (8447129020) is particularly important for importers of rib and interlock machines, which use both cylinder and dial needle beds.

A cylinder-and-dial machine uses two sets of needles — one in the rotating cylinder and one in a horizontal dial — to produce double-knit, rib, or interlock structures. An open-top cylinder machine uses only cylinder needles and produces single-jersey or similar single-bed fabrics. The presence or absence of a dial needle bed is the defining mechanical distinction between these two lines.
Japanese manufacturers of large-diameter circular knitters typically operate on order-to-manufacture lead times of several months, and ocean freight from Japan adds transit time. Buyers should factor in port congestion, currency fluctuation affecting yen-denominated pricing, and the availability of local technical service support when planning capital equipment procurement.
